Municipal board officers elected

Members of the Lake County Municipal League have elected Hawthorn Woods Mayor Joe Mancino as president of the 2016-17 board of directors. Wadsworth Mayor Glenn Ryback was elected the board's vice-president, while Libertyville Mayor Terry Weppler was elected secretary and Round Lake Beach Mayor Rich Hill was elected treasurer. The organization is a council of 42 Lake County cities and villages working to improve government operation through information sharing and networking, intergovernmental cooperation, and advocacy for the common interests of its membership. The board is comprised of eight mayors or presidents and one village or city administrator. Directors are: Maria Lasday, village administrator of Bannockburn; and mayors Dominic Marturano of Lindenhurst, Wayne Motley of Waukegan, Tom Poynton of Lake Zurich and Donny Schmit of Fox Lake. Associate members are also part of LCML and represent consultants, engineers and equipment suppliers.
